Ingredients
- Chicken Thighs: 8 pieces (bone-in, skin-on)
- Scotch Bonnet Peppers: 2, finely minced
- Garlic Cloves: 3, minced
- Fresh Ginger: 1 tablespoon, grated
- Soy Sauce: 3 tablespoons
- Brown Sugar: 3 tablespoons
- Lime Juice: 2 tablespoons
- Honey: 2 tablespoons
- Olive Oil: 1 tablespoon
- Salt: 1 teaspoon
- Black Pepper: ½ teaspoon
Instructions
- Preheat Your Equipment: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) or fire up a grill. Line a baking tray with foil or lightly oil a grill pan.
- Combine Ingredients: In a saucepan, heat olive oil over medium heat. Sauté garlic, ginger, and scotch bonnet peppers for 1–2 minutes. Add brown sugar, honey, soy sauce, lime juice, salt, and black pepper. Simmer for 5–7 minutes until thick and syrupy.
- Prepare Your Cooking Vessel: Place chicken thighs on the prepared tray or grill pan. Pat dry for better skin crisping.
- Assemble the Dish: Brush a generous layer of glaze over each piece of chicken. Reserve half the glaze for later.
- Cook to Perfection: Bake or grill for 35–40 minutes, turning once and glazing again halfway through. The internal temp should reach 165°F (75°C).
- Finishing Touches: Broil for 2–3 minutes at the end to caramelize the glaze. Remove and let rest for 5 minutes.
- Serve and Enjoy: Plate up with fresh herbs, lime wedges, or a tropical slaw.
Notes
- Baste the chicken multiple times for a thicker, richer glaze.
- Use gloves when handling scotch bonnet peppers.
- Let chicken rest after cooking to retain juices.
